Onions for Hair Loss?

Onions are an important ingredient of a deliciously cooked meal but do you know that they are also used as a hair loss remedy?


During the middle ages, for example, people who suffer from hair loss are advised to rub onions on their scalp. Sulfur deficiency is considered to be one of the causes of hair loss and the potency of onions as a hair loss solution can be attributed to its high sulfur content.


Using onions as a hair loss solution is not always a good idea though. Who wants to be noticed because of their onion-pungent smelling head? People will prefer to use hair loss treatment alternatives over the spicy smelling onion applied in their heads.
